Yesterday was Mary Haglund’s birthday, so of course, we were there to celebrate with her at Mary’s Gourmet Diner. Then we went by Underdog Records and grabbed a few LPs. Not a big haul this week. Here’s it is:

Hall_and_Oates,_Abandoned_Luncheonette_(1973)
©Atlantic Records
  • Peter Gabriel – Plays Live — I got this on Tuesday from Underdog Records but waited to mention it until today. This is a great live album from 1983, recorded on tour in 1982 for the Peter Gabriel (Security) album. There were some overdubs done but most of the stuff was live. I really enjoyed listening to it. VG+.
  • Daryl Hall & John Oates – Abandoned Luncheonette — The second studio album from H&O and it’s a beauty. There are some really fantastic tunes on here, including “She’s Gone,” the title track, “When the Morning Comes,” “Laughing Boy” (which happens to be my favorite track on the album after “She’s Gone”). Love the cover, as well. VG+.
  • Go-Go’s – Vacation — The title track is the best song on the album but the whole thing was a fun listen. I am glad we have it. VG+.
  • Electric Light Orchestra – Olé ELO — This is a compilation album from ELO and it has a lot of early songs on it and some of it I’m not a fan of. Nothing is wrong with it, just not my favorite songs. However, there are some of my favorite ELO tunes, too. “Can’t Get It Out of My Head,” “Evil Woman” and “Strange Magic” are some of my overall faves from the band. VG+.
  • Commodores – Nightshift — It’s not classic Commodores, by any means but it does feed my synth-pop early 80s R&B. I had this album on cassette back when it came out because I forgot to send in my card to not get the “selection of the month” from RCA Music Club (before it was BMG Music Club). Granted the only tunes that I really care about on here is the title track, “Woman in My Life” and “Animal Instinct.” VG+.
